Shashi is a farmer turned businessman who started off with humble beginnings and ended up makingmillions. His life was never simple. Being born in a poor farmer's family in India, he barely got goodeducation or learned technical skills. He owes it to the world to train him for a millionaire's life in its ownway.As fun as it sounds, Shashi's life has been really tough. He went from door to door asking for moneyafter his father's demise and had people banging his door demanding their money back. Day and night,the mother and son would only sit in the quiet of their home and wait for their farm produce to come,but that was hardly ever enough to afford them a respectable living.Fast forward to when his brother sponsored them to the UK, Shashi finally saw some hope and bought asmall convenience store. He got married to the most wonderful woman, Mina, and together theybecame parents to three girls. Shashi's most breakthrough moment in life was when he bought his firstcoffee shop as a franchisee.Thanks to the skills and traits Shashi had acquired from life, the business kept multiplying at a goodpace. When the franchise business suffered some setbacks in the recession years, Shashi started his ownbrand making lemonade out of life's lemons. This business acquired the value of multi-million pounds.Sometime later, he sold it off after suffering a brutal heart attack. Today, he is a proud grandparent andlives a healthy life with his family, leaving behind a rich legacy for the next generations.
